Skip to main content

2 posts tagged with "AWS Route 53"

View All Tags

How to Transfer a Website Domain from AWS Route 53 to Cloudflare: A Step-by-Step Guide

· 5 min read

How to transfer a domain from AWS Route 53 to Cloudflare. This process might seem a bit complicated, but we'll break it down into manageable steps to ensure a smooth transition.

If you haven't seen our previous video on transferring a domain from GoDaddy to AWS, you can check it out for reference. Now, let's dive into the process of moving a domain from AWS to Cloudflare.

If you haven't seen our previous video on transferring a domain from GoDaddy to AWS, you can check it out for reference. Now, let's dive into the process of moving a domain from AWS to Cloudflare.

Refer How To Transfer Your Domain from GoDaddy to AWS


Step 1: Preparing the Domain for Transfer

AWS Config

Before we proceed, ensure you have:

  • Access to your AWS Route 53 account.
  • A Cloudflare account ready for the transfer.


In AWS Route 53:

AWS Route 53
  1. Navigate to the Registered Domains section in the AWS Management Console.
  2. Find the domain you want to transfer.
  3. Before initiating the transfer, disable Auto-Renew for this domain. This prevents automatic renewal during the transfer process.
  4. Turn off the Transfer Lock to allow other registrars, like Cloudflare, to accept the domain. This change may take a few minutes to propagate.

Step 2: Obtain the Authorization Code

Authorization Code Transfer Out
  1. In the Registered Domains section, look for the Transfer Out option.
  2. Click on Transfer to Another Registrar and request the Authorization Code. AWS will generate a code for you. Copy this code, as it will be needed to authorize the transfer to Cloudflare.

Step 3: Starting the Transfer on Cloudflare

Domain Registration
  1. Go to Cloudflare and log into your account.
  2. In the Cloudflare dashboard, navigate to the Domain Registration section.
Transfer Domain
  1. Choose the Transfer Domain option and enter the domain name you wish to transfer. Click Continue.
  2. If you haven't already added the domain in Cloudflare, you'll be prompted to do so now. Enter the domain name and click Continue.

Step 4: Updating Nameservers in AWS Route 53

Nameservers

To successfully transfer your domain, you need to update the nameservers:

  1. Go back to your AWS Route 53 account.
  2. Navigate to the Registered Domains section and select your domain.
Edit Name Servers
  1. Click on Edit Name Servers. Update the nameservers to the ones provided by Cloudflare.
  2. Always keep a backup of your original nameserver settings in case you need to revert changes.
  3. Save the changes. Note that DNS propagation can take up to 24 hours.

Step 5: Validate the Nameservers

  • After a few hours, return to your Cloudflare dashboard. Cloudflare will automatically validate the updated nameservers.
  • Once validated, your domain will be marked as Ready to Transfer in Cloudflare.

Step 6: Finalize the Transfer in Cloudflare

Cloudflare
  1. In the Cloudflare dashboard, select the domain that is ready for transfer.
  2. Enter the Authorization Code you copied from AWS Route 53.
  3. Review the pricing details and add a payment method in Cloudflare to cover the transfer fee.
  4. Confirm and proceed with the transfer. Cloudflare will then initiate the transfer process.

Step 7: Approve the Transfer in AWS Route 53

Approve

AWS will send an email to the domain's registered email address to approve the transfer:

  1. Check your email and click the link provided to approve the domain transfer. This step is crucial to confirm that you consent to the transfer.
  2. Approve the transfer in the AWS console to expedite the process.

Step 8: Monitoring the Transfer

Active
  • The transfer might take a few hours to complete. You can monitor the status in the Cloudflare dashboard.
  • Once the transfer is complete, the domain status in Cloudflare will change to Active.

Step 9: Post-Transfer Configurations

  1. Verify that the domain is properly set up in Cloudflare and that the DNS records are configured correctly.
  2. Adjust any additional settings in Cloudflare, such as automatic renewals and domain locks.

Conclusion

Congratulations! You've successfully transferred your domain from AWS Route 53 to Cloudflare. Remember, it's always a good idea to keep backups of your original settings and follow each step carefully to avoid any interruptions.

Refer Cloud Consulting

Ready to take your cloud infrastructure to the next level? Please reach out to us Contact Us

Other Blogs

Step-by-Step Guide: Install and Configure GitLab on AWS EC2 | DevOps CI/CD with GitLab on AWS
Simplifying AWS Notifications: A Guide to User Notifications

How To Transfer Your Domain from GoDaddy to AWS

· 5 min read

Are you considering switching your domain registrar from GoDaddy to Amazon Web Services (AWS)? Whether you're seeking more control, better pricing, or enhanced features, transferring your domain doesn't have to be complicated. In this comprehensive guide, we'll walk you through the process of migrating your domain from GoDaddy to AWS.

Seamlessly transition your domain: Follow our step-by-step guide to transfer from GoDaddy to AWS hassle-free.

Before You Begin: Transfer Requirements

To prevent abuse and preserve domain ownership integrity, domain registrars, including GoDaddy and AWS, adhere to certain transfer requirements: The domain must be registered with the current registrar or transferred to the current registrar for at least 60 days.If restored from expiration, the domain must be at least 60 days post-restoration.Ensure the domain doesn't have prohibitive status codes like clientTransferProhibited, pendingDelete, pendingTransfer, redemptionPeriod, or serverTransferProhibited. You can find the current status by searching for your domain on the ICANN WHOIS website.Make any required changes (like to the domain owner) well in advance, as certain TLDs restrict transfers during updates.If you encounter issues or need more information on status codes, consult ICANN's policies or check out their EPP status codes website.

Step 1: Confirm AWS Support for Your Domain's TLD AWS Support Start by checking whether Route 53 supports your domain's top-level domain (TLD). Visit to check availability.

Step 2: Connect with GoDaddy Support The first step in transferring your domain is to get in touch with GoDaddy's customer support. You will: Sign in to your GoDaddy account. Unlock the domain from GoDaddy's interface. Obtain your account number. Keep in mind that after making changes, it can take 2 to 3 days for them to propagate.

Step 3: Prepare for AWS Transfer Now, head over to your AWS account. Here are the things you need to take care of: Make sure your domain is not in a locked state; AWS cannot transfer a locked domain. Discontinue auto-renew as it won't be necessary anymore. Contact GoDaddy's help center to receive important domain transfer information.

Step 4: Update Settings with GoDaddy

Update Settings

Ensure the registrant contact email is current for communication and transfer authorization purposes. Unlock the domain to allow transfer. Verify the domain is in a transferable state. If DNSSEC is enabled, disable it for the transfer (reactivate it in AWS later). Secure an authorization code from GoDaddy, except for certain TLDs like .co.za, .es, .uk, and .co.uk, which have different requirements (e.g., updating IPS tags for .uk domains).

Step 5: Request Domain Transfer on AWS

Domain Transfer on AWS

Initiate the domain transfer request using AWS Route 53, which will verify the domain status for you. After initiating the transfer, it will officially take 2 to 5 days to complete. Within the AWS Route 53 console: Click on 'Registered Domains'. Opt for either transferring a single domain or multiple domains. Hit 'Check' to confirm the domain is transferable. Follow AWS's prompts to proceed with the transfer. AWS will provide status updates on the transfer request through the console.

Step 6: Post-Transfer Setup

Post-Transfer Setup

Once the domain is in AWS's hands, you'll receive a notification. You'll then need to: Update the Name Servers in Route 53. Verify that hosted records match your desired configuration. Configure auto-renew to avoid losing your domain at the end of the registration period. Enable the transfer lock for additional security. Go to the hosted zone to review domain status and Name Server records.

Step 7: Additional Checks and Settings

Additional Checks

This involves making sure all DNS settings, including MX records and other configurations, are properly set up for your email and website. For example: If you've moved from GoDaddy's Outlook email to another provider, update the MX records accordingly. Add any additional DNS records, like TXT for email domain validation and others required for your domain to function correctly.

Step 8: Final Confirmation and Testing Ensure that everything works as expected by: Configure auto-renewal and transfer lock settings to protect your domain. Verify and update any DNS settings in Route 53 to map correctly to your services. Confirming the Name Server records match. Testing traffic routing to your website. Performing email send and receive tests to confirm that email delivery is functional.

Conclusion

When choosing to transfer your domain to AWS Route 53: Remember that DNS records, including MX and TXT records, need to be reconfigured in AWS. Be aware of special considerations for certain TLDs, including those related to renewal periods and IPS tags (.uk and .co.uk domains, for instance). Have all name server data ready if you plan to use DNS services outside of AWS after the transfer. If utilizing DNSSEC, coordinate between GoDaddy and AWS to ensure proper transfer of DNSSEC keys, or risk DNS resolution failure. By following these steps and understanding the requirements, you can ensure a hassle-free transition of your domain from GoDaddy to AWS Route 53, reaping the benefits of a robust, scalable hosting environment for your website and applications.